Transaction 94180764d61a8e6d894083581ca2f6d975a78e90554ce213e98ce7d527770ef1
1 Input
1 Output
-
94180764d61a8e6d894083581ca2f6d975a78e90554ce213e98ce7d527770ef1:0
- value
- 109558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93a20bab3bf021b53297fe7707eadf94be0917f1 OP_EQUAL
- address
- 3F9dNsFaWFrEJWmePHidwJMU84ozKxruG4